当前位置: 首页 >科技 > 内容

.Java 去除数组中空值 🔄👩‍💻

科技
导读 在编程的世界里,处理数组是一项基本技能。然而,有时数组中会出现一些空值,这可能会导致程序运行时出现错误或异常。今天,我们就来探讨一

在编程的世界里,处理数组是一项基本技能。然而,有时数组中会出现一些空值,这可能会导致程序运行时出现错误或异常。今天,我们就来探讨一下如何用Java语言去除数组中的空值。🚀

首先,我们需要创建一个数组,并向其中添加一些数据,包括一些空值。例如,我们可以创建一个字符串类型的数组,然后填充一些内容和空字符串。👇

```java

String[] arrayWithNulls = {"Apple", null, "Banana", "", "Cherry"};

```

接下来,我们需要创建一个新的数组,用来存储去除空值后的结果。这里我们可以使用ArrayList来动态地添加元素,最后再将其转换为数组。🌟

```java

List listWithoutNulls = new ArrayList<>();

for (String item : arrayWithNulls) {

if (item != null && !item.trim().isEmpty()) {

listWithoutNulls.add(item);

}

}

```

最后,我们将ArrayList转换为数组,以便于后续操作。🎈

```java

String[] arrayWithoutNulls = listWithoutNulls.toArray(new String[0]);

```

这样,我们就成功地去除了数组中的所有空值,得到了一个只包含有效数据的新数组。🎉

通过这个简单的例子,我们学习了如何在Java中处理数组中的空值问题。希望这个小技巧能够帮助你在未来的项目中更加得心应手!👏

Java 编程技巧 数组处理

免责声明:本文由用户上传,如有侵权请联系删除!